The sawtooth wave jig is one of the modern
heavy separation equipment. Because of its large
processing capacity, wide selection of particle
size range, simple operation and maintenance, it is
widely used as a rough selection or selection to
sort placer gold, tin, titanium, hematite, Minerals
such as iron ore and coal, especially in the field
of manganese ore and barite beneficiation, have
been widely used. Traditional jigging machines are
mostly driven by circular eccentricity, and their
jigging pulsation curves are mostly sinusoidal.
Because the rising and falling water flow speeds
and action times produced by the diaphragm movement
are basically the same, it is not conducive to the
loosening of the jig bed and the ore particles. The
specific gravity is stratified, which affects the
selection ratio and recovery rate of the equipment.
The sawtooth wave jig is an energy-saving
reselection equipment developed and improved on the
basis of the traditional jigging machine based on
the theoretical layering law of the jig bed. Its
jigging pulsation curve is in a saw-tooth shape,
making the rising water flow faster than falling
Water flow: short rise time and long fall time;
overcome sine wave, pulsating curve jig The
resulting defects of rising and falling water flow
and the same action time enhance the looseness of
the bed, alleviate the inhalation effect, fully
settle the heavy mineral particles in the mineral,
and greatly improve the separation ratio and
recovery rate of the equipment. Compared with the
sine wave jigging machine, it has improved: Sn
3.01%, W 5.5%, Pb 1.63%, Zn 2.04%; water
consumption is reduced by 30%-40%, floor space is
reduced by 1/3, and the stroke can be adjusted.
Electromagnetic adjustment motor is used for drag
so that the stroke can be adjusted steplessly. Its
performance has reached the domestic advanced level
and is currently one of the ideal energy-saving
reselection equipment.
